This paper describes the process of using peer assessment and feedback strategy to enhance the effectiveness on learning computer programming. Students worked in pairs to complete learning tasks collaboratively on computer programming. Data were collected using questionnaires and quizzes for further analysis. The findings show that the students were satisfied with the peer as-sessment and feedback strategy in learning computer programming. Moreover, their actual per-formance was also better when compared with that achieved using traditional teaching method
The research on computer supported collaborative learning (CSCL) is extensive and it remains an area...
Peer review technique used in educational context could be beneficial for students from several poin...
In the last few years, undergraduate university courses with a practical orientation, such as progr...
Active learning is considered by many academics as an important and effective learning strategy. Ass...
Peer assessment is a technique that has been successfully employed in a variety of academic discipli...
There have been many successful examples of new methodological approaches developed to help students...
A variety of technology enhanced teaching strategies and learning activities have been applied in ed...
This paper discusses the potential for web-based peer assessment, based on the numerous possibilitie...
Using peer assessment in the classroom to increase student engagement by actively involving the pupi...
Teaching introductory programming modules in higher education is highly challenging. In particular,...
Peer assessment is a technique that has been successfully employed in a variety of academic discipli...
Group work, group projects and collaborative learning encourage students to learn from other student...
none2noPeer assessment mechanism is becoming increasingly important in different computer programmin...
Techniques such as Pair Programming, or allowing students to run their programs against a reference ...
A common theme from the National Student Survey is that students want more feedback, but increasing ...
The research on computer supported collaborative learning (CSCL) is extensive and it remains an area...
Peer review technique used in educational context could be beneficial for students from several poin...
In the last few years, undergraduate university courses with a practical orientation, such as progr...
Active learning is considered by many academics as an important and effective learning strategy. Ass...
Peer assessment is a technique that has been successfully employed in a variety of academic discipli...
There have been many successful examples of new methodological approaches developed to help students...
A variety of technology enhanced teaching strategies and learning activities have been applied in ed...
This paper discusses the potential for web-based peer assessment, based on the numerous possibilitie...
Using peer assessment in the classroom to increase student engagement by actively involving the pupi...
Teaching introductory programming modules in higher education is highly challenging. In particular,...
Peer assessment is a technique that has been successfully employed in a variety of academic discipli...
Group work, group projects and collaborative learning encourage students to learn from other student...
none2noPeer assessment mechanism is becoming increasingly important in different computer programmin...
Techniques such as Pair Programming, or allowing students to run their programs against a reference ...
A common theme from the National Student Survey is that students want more feedback, but increasing ...
The research on computer supported collaborative learning (CSCL) is extensive and it remains an area...
Peer review technique used in educational context could be beneficial for students from several poin...
In the last few years, undergraduate university courses with a practical orientation, such as progr...